Promoting Healthy, Active Aging Through Lifelong Learning and Community Engagement
from Focus on OLLI · host OLLI
The program at UNLV's Osher Lifelong Learning Institute (OLLI) engages retired and semi-retired individuals in civic activities and lifelong learning, supported by the Bernard Osher Foundation. Nursing and nutrition students from UNLV interact with OLLI members to learn about healthy, active aging. Nursing students gain exposure to healthy older adults, while nutrition students present research on functional foods and diets like the Mediterranean diet. OLLI members are active, competitive, and curious, fostering a dynamic learning environment. Upcoming projects include lifestyle medicine and digital literacy workshops to enhance independence and social connections among older adults.
